// LocateMemorystoreRequestDuration is a histogram that tracks the latency of
// requests from the Locate to Memorystore.
LocateMemorystoreRequestDuration = promauto.NewHistogramVec(
prometheus.HistogramOpts{
Name: "locate_memorystore_request_duration",
Help: "A histogram of request latency to Memorystore.",
Buckets: []float64{.005, .01, .025, .05, .1, .25, .5, 1,
2, 4, 6, 8, 10, 12, 14, 16, 18, 20, 22, 24, 26, 28, 30},
},
[]string{"type", "field", "status"},
)
